How do weather alert subscriptions differ across delivery channels?

Weather alert subscriptions typically provide alerts through various delivery channels, including email, SMS, and mobile app notifications. For instance, users can opt for weather alerts delivered in an easily understandable format via email or receive instant notifications on their mobile devices. Clime provides push notifications for severe weather alerts, making it highly accessible for users who prefer instant updates without needing to check their emails.

What is the typical pricing model for weather alert subscriptions?

Most weather alert services follow a subscription model that offers both free and paid options. Free tiers usually come with basic alerts and might include advertisements, while paid subscriptions offer enhanced features, such as detailed environmental information and customizable alerts. Can you customize alert types and geographic coverage in weather alert services?

Indeed, many weather alert services allow users to customize the types of alerts they receive. For example, Clime lets users configure alerts for specific weather conditions like hurricanes, tornadoes, or lightning for their saved locations. This level of customization helps users focus on the alerts that matter most to their specific area or interests, ensuring they remain informed without being overwhelmed by irrelevant notifications.
